[0019] figure 1 is a diagram of an example preview system in network environment 100 . A user of the client device can preview the application without installing the application on the client device. Rather than installing the application on the client device, the application is executed on a host server remote from the client device. This host server then provides a preview session to the client device by transmitting the application's media stream to the client device over the network. An example environment for hosting such a preview session is at figure 1 shown in .

Abstract

A client system presents, within an execution environment of an application, a third-party media stream distinct from the application, received from a remote host server via a network. The client system detects interaction events during presentation of the third-party media stream, and transmits descriptions of the detected interaction events to the remote host server. The application may be pre-cued prior to presentation, e.g., to minimize start-up time. In some implementations, a side-band message channel is established to facilitate communication between the client system and the remote host server.
